Moreton-in-Marsh US_7GR_LOC349_RP_3041

Moreton-in-Marsh, Gloucesterhsire. Photographed by the USaF early in 1944, prior to D-Day, with barracks, truck parks and Sherman tanks parked in the main street

EDITORS COMMENTS
This print from the Historic England Archive takes us back in time to Moreton-in-Marsh, Gloucestershire during the early months of 1944. As World War II was reaching its climax and preparations for D-Day were underway, the United States Air Force captured this aerial shot of a bustling military scene. The image showcases an extraordinary sight - Sherman tanks lined up along the main street, creating an unexpected juxtaposition against the quaint urban backdrop. The town's barracks and truck parks are also clearly visible, highlighting their crucial role in supporting wartime operations. This snapshot provides a rare glimpse into the impact of war on everyday life, as residents navigate through this transformed landscape.
